Good Journalism - Trust Us!

I recently stumbled across this new site called NewsTrust.  NewsTrust is a content aggregator/social media site that touts itself as a filter for good journalism.  Users are allowed to post links and rate stories based on their accuracy and fairness.  There are several ways of doing this, but all stories promoted on the site are subject to this crowdsourced review process.  They have several tutorials and guides to help new users understand exactly what the site portends to do.

In addition, NewsTrust users are asked to go on NewsHunts to find the best stories in given topics and sniff out bad news.  The site also has a TruthSquad, where users look at claims made by sources or the media and are allowed to vote on the statement's accuracy.
